Error analysis and calibration of a spectroscopic Mueller matrix polarimeter using a short-pulse laser source

This paper deals with an error analysis together with the calibration of a spectroscopic Mueller polarimeter with dual rotating retarders; both of them take into consideration the elliptical birefringence characteristics of each rotating device. In doing so, the precision currently given for the Mueller matrix elements is drastically improved. Simulations enabled us, first, to determine the measurement error on each element of the Mueller matrix without a sample and, second, to adopt a method of calibration. Experimental results and corrections highlight the interest of taking elliptical birefringence and dichroism into account.
